China Beijing Beijing Alibaba Cloud
Websites on 8.140.134.100
- Domain names that have been bound:
- 2023-01-13-----2023-06-08yffshun.cn
- 2022-03-21-----2023-05-30www.xjilove.com
- 2023-04-08-----2023-04-08www.yffshun.cn
- 2022-02-25-----2022-02-25sj.yffshun.cn
- website server lookup history
- bysm03.cicgak.com
- www.ksteas.com
- 06d0ee684e.zsyknk.com
- lewangxiao.com
- hghg91.com
- app.buhuovip.com
- te84.com
- fbe9bf.com
- www.yymvp.com
- 009809.teishuanpandhy.com
- www.80kj.com
- wofa777.com
- www.fanxijia.com
- lpcbdx.com
- www.yilakai.com
- www.ow8ow2.com
- pgj3me.whchino.com
- purbhub.com
- 81099.cc
- zkbtap.lqqun.com
- hosting ip address lookup history
- 85.128.191.117
- 104.22.50.18
- 104.16.62.107
- 8.138.156.96
- 23.40.192.5
- 17.151.239.44
- 154.36.181.181
- 13.227.75.169
- 107.155.72.26
- 104.149.215.154
- 103.108.64.183
- 154.215.180.236
- 104.165.41.30
- 94.130.73.193
- 210.13.72.145
- 35.163.253.67
- 156.251.18.6
- 47.103.87.49
- 43.207.52.228
- 112.126.97.176
